OVERVIEW

Libbey’s Category Marketing Manager is a core business driver and change agent to drive solutions, process improvements and plans for growth. This role proactively manages marketing strategy and business fundamentals, in the assigned categories. The Category Marketing Manager delivers business analysis and actions recommendations to address issues, drive working strategies and deliver change and growth for the assigned categories.

This specific Category Manager Role will report to the Senior Director of Marketing and is responsible for the dinnerware and serveware/buffetware categories.

RESPONSIBILITIES

  • Category Business Strategy and Planning
    • Own, develop and execute an end-to-end vision and strategy/plan to grow revenue and margin, aligning with overall business objectives.
    • Acquire and socialize knowledge of trends in product families and major customers.
    • Develop and manage Category Strategy, Annual Operating Plan and Strategic Long-Range Plan.
    • Stay connected with industry, customer, and end-user / consumer trends.
    • Proactively develop insightful analysis on critical business issues.
  • Portfolio and Assortment Management
    • Manage ongoing product lifecycle analysis.
    • Initiate and provide key input on Excess and Obsolete process, slow-moving inventory and SKU rationalization
    • Collaborate with New Product Development regarding incoming product assortment.
    • Contribute to portfolio health via support for demand planning/forecasting, quality solutions, packaging enhancements or other product related needs that improve commercial performance of existing products.
    • Manage market position, brand architecture and brand positioning for assigned categories.
  • Commercial Sales Support
    • Configure projects/opportunities as needed.
    • Manage cross-channel conflict to ensure portfolio integrity.
    • Create and optimize product training, as needed, to ensure selling competency within assigned categories.
    • Identify and implement marketing tactics in support of outlined strategies to drive sale revenue in assigned categories (examples: marketing collateral, website content, tradeshow activations, etc)
  • Business Input
    • Produce key inputs to Commercial Monthly Operating Reviews.
    • Lead Quarterly Category Review, driving an understanding of business results and recommendations for responding or scaling.
